    D-26Nike 2B, 2C/12H, 20A/12L-UA, [[8L-H)DetroitBelle Isle, Michigan [[Shared double Launch facility with D-23, separate IFCs)1955 - Nov 1968Obliterated, City of Detroit. Now a part of Maheras-Gentry Park
    42°21′22″N 082°56′58″W / 42.35611°N 82.94944°W / 42.35611; -82.94944 [[D-26-CS)Obliterated, City of Detroit. Located on Belle Isle, south of Blue Heron Lagoon, East side of Lakeside Drive
    42°20′43″N 082°57′20″W / 42.34528°N 82.95556°W / 42.34528; -82.95556 [[D-26-LS)
